Zambia’s economy would crash if we stopped exporting power – Zesco

ZESCO Managing Director Victor Mapani says even if the country is anticipated to experience load shedding due to drought, the company cannot stop exporting power because doing so would collapse the country’s economy. Faith Musonda defends her assets, opposes forfeiture

FAITH Musonda has opposed to the Anti-Corruption Commission’s application to have her properties forfeited to the State, insisting that they were legitimately acquired and are not proceeds of crime. RTSA no longer uncompromising, notes Tayali

TRANSPORT and Logistics Minister Frank Tayali says the Road Transport and Safety Agency has dropped its guard in strictly enforcing road safety rules. Govt tasks ZNS to start preparations for irrigated maize

DEFENCE Minister Ambrose Lufuma has tasked the Zambia National Service (ZNS) to immediately start preparations for irrigated maize in all farms that have centre pivots irrigation equipment. Chinese national accused of manslaughter absconds court

A CHINESE national accused of manslaughter in connection with the death of a 13-year-old girl did not enter a plea before the Lusaka High Court as scheduled yesterday. Kambidima savours revenge against Matero Magic

GREEN Buffaloes are champions of the 2024 Bridging Sports Foundation tournament after emerging victorious over national champions Matero Magic in an exhilarating showdown on Sunday. Imenda’s lawyers furious at Sean Tembo for sitting at the bar

LAWYERS representing UPND Secretary General Batuke Imenda have argued before the Lusaka Magistrates’ Court that Patriots for Economic Progress (PeP) leader Sean Tembo’s presence at the bar is illegal. Cabinet approves amendment of Lands Tribunal, ZIALE, Matrimonial Causes bills

CABINET has approved various bills to be presented in the National Assembly which include the Lands Tribunal amendment bill, ZIALE amendment bill and the Matrimonial Causes amendment bill among others.
